Transaction 101359d052e41704ea64595615b92539e6f5ca631aa6c3e1ff3a289976982c41
1 Input
1 Output
-
101359d052e41704ea64595615b92539e6f5ca631aa6c3e1ff3a289976982c41:0
- value
- 3473668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c8effd286baf08194cba9ddbc652dca31d8535e OP_EQUAL
- address
- 3EWDqAadtNTq2RpNmQz5T2Hp7YugBS5j72